No, there is no direct train from Barnsley to Southport. However, there are services departing from Barnsley station and arriving at Southport station via Huddersfield.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 16m.
Barnsley to Southport train services, operated by Northern Trains Limited, depart from Barnsley station.
Barnsley to Southport train services, operated by Northern Trains Limited, arrive at Southport station.

The distance between Barnsley and Southport is 101.3 km. The road distance is 133 km.
You can take a train from Barnsley to Southport via Huddersfield and Manchester Victoria in around 3h 34m.
